At a Democratic National Committee fundraiser in New York Friday, President Obama attributed people’s pervasive sense the world is falling apart to “social media.” “The world’s always been messy … we’re just noticing now in part because of social media,” Obama said. “I can see why a lot of folks are troubled,” he said. But American military superiority has never been greater, he added, according to a pool report.
